The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Gedling local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T sales between April 2011 and December 2020 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2018 sale was for 2%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 2% below the HPI over time, until the December 2020 sale, where it falls to 5%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 5% below the HPI.

What might 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T be worth now?

33 SWALLOW CRESCENT might now be worth an estimated £355,945.

This is based on house price inflation of 24.9%, between December 2020 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the Gedling local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 24.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T of £285,000 on 4th December 2020. For the value to have increased from £285,000 to £355,945 over the four years to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Gedling local authority area.
  • The December 2020 sale price of £285,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T has not materially changed since December 2020.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

33 SWALLOW CRESCENT sits on a plot of roughly 0.066 of an acre, or 269m². The below map shows the location of 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 33 SWALLOW CRESCENT).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
